$PROCESSOR_ARCHITECTURE seems to contain the architecture of the host, but we need the architecture the current MinGW shell is targeting. $MINGW_CHOST seems to be just that, and on my system it's either i686-w64-mingw32 (mingw32.exe) or x86_64-w64-mingw32 (mingw64.exe) (No idea what it looks like for Windows on ARM...) As fixing this would otherwise break existing savegames, I bumped the SAVEGAMEVER to "YQ2-4" and added a quirk for older savegameversions: On Windows i386 savegames that contain "AMD64" instead of "i386" as architecture are also accepted. (For YQ2-1 this didn't seem necessary, apparently "i386" was hardcoded) |

This is a bugfixed version of id Software's Quake II missionpack "The Reckoning", developed by Xatrix Software. Hundred bugs were fixed, this version should run much more stable than the the old SDK version. It should be used with the "Yamagi Quake II Client", but may work with other clients too. For more information visit http://www.yamagi.org/quake2. Installation for FreeBSD, Linux and OpenBSD: -------------------------------------------- 1. Type "make" or "gmake" to compile the game.so. 2. Create a subdirectory xatrix/ in your quake2 directory. 3. Copy pak0.pak and videos/ from the the Reckoning CD to the newly created directory xatrix/. 4. Copy release/game.so to xatrix/. 5. Start the game with "./quake2 +set game xatrix" Installation for OS X: ---------------------- 1. Create a subdirectory xatrix/ in your quake2 directory. 2. Copy pak0.pak and videos/ from the the Reckoning CD to the newly created directory xatrix/. 3. Copy game.so from the zip-archive to xatrix/. 4. Start the game with "quake2 +set game xatrix" If you want to compile 'xatrix' for OS X from source, please take a look at the "Installation" section of the README of the Yamagi Quake II client. In the same file the integration into an app-bundle is explained. Installation for Windows: ------------------------- 1. Create a subdirectory xatrix\ in your quake2 directory. 2. Copy pak0.pak and videos\ from the the Reckoning CD to the newly created directory xatrix\. 3. Copy game.dll from the zip-archive to xatrix/. 4. Start the game with "quake2.exe +set game xatrix" If you want to compile 'xatrix' for Windows from source, please take a look at the "Installation" section of the README of the Yamagi Quake II client.
